Movie starts at 8:30 pm on the Hippy Dippy Pool Deck (In case of inclement weather, activities will be moved to the children’s play room across from the front desk in the lobby)

  • Sundays – A Goofy Movie
  • Mondays – Meet the Robinsons
  • Tuesdays – Hercules
  • Wednesdays – Pocahontas (See our Pocahontas page)
  • Thursdays – Ratatouille
  • Fridays – The Emperor’s New Groove
  • Saturdays – Wreck-It Ralph

It's best to call and add any room requests to your reservation. You can do that any time from the day you book up until 4-5 days prior to your arrival. I would word your request as "upper floor" and "lake view". If those 2 requests are granted, you will have a quiet location.


I agree, what your asking for is a standard room. Are you booked standard?
 
Yes standard. Thanks

I agree 4th floor, lakeview and all the standard rooms in the 60's are lakeview. Keep in mind that building 3 (50's) and 4 (60's) top floor are the most requested standard area's since you can possibly get a glimpse of the night time fireworks from some of those rooms. Most 4th floor lakeview rooms in buildings 3, 4, 5 or 6 have beautiful views unless they are blocked by tree's but you will get the quite. Even the lakeview rooms in building 2 are good but they can be a trek after a long day at the parks. There are 2 Standard Pool view area's.
They are highlighted in green on this resort map:
http://i962.photobucket.com/albums/ae107/braverman4/POP Century Thread/PopCenturyMap2012RoomCategoriesFINAL.jpg

Do you want ground floor, top floor or something in between?
Do you like the 50's era/theme, Lady and the Tramp? or the the 80's/90's era?
These are the options for a basic standard room:


I am not sure exactly what the options will be with a standard pool view since the standard pools are only in the 50's or the 80's/90's.
If you get the same options as above, make sure you don't check something that is not available for a standard pool room such as Lake View or Landscape view or 60's or 70's since there is no way they could assign you one of those rooms.

Personally I prefer 50's since I love Lady and the Tramp and if you get building 1 or 3, you are closer to Classic Hall. But there are many that love the 80's/90's pool since it is a little less crowded and from building 9 you can cut across the parking lot for a shortcut to the buses. It is really personal preference.
